  • Patent number: 8542564
    Abstract: A method of designating a disk recording capacity and an optical disk recording apparatus using the method, where a maximum recording capacity is designated by measuring an external disturbance for disk regions. The method of designating a disk recording capacity includes: partitioning a disk into a plurality of disk regions, and measuring external disturbance at the disk regions; setting a disk speed based on the measured external disturbance, and designating disk regions excluding the disk regions where the external disturbance is measured as recordable disk regions; and calculating a maximum disk recording capacity based on the designated recordable disk regions.

  • Patent number: 7496008
    Abstract: An apparatus and a method removing offset of a Phase Lock Loop (PLL) circuit in a disc drive without using a disc when data playback is performed, the apparatus including an ENDEC module and a PLL circuit. The ENDEC module outputs a binary signal if an offset removal mode is set. The PLL circuit removes the offset of the PLL circuit by comparing a phase of the binary signal with a phase of a channel bit clock signal. Therefore, a time to remove the offset of the PLL circuit is reduced and the possibility not to remove the offset of the PLL circuit due to a damaged disc is prevented.

  • Patent number: 7379403
    Abstract: A tilt adjusting apparatus including a digital signal processor, a first drive integrated circuit, and a tilt adjuster. When an optical recording medium is loaded into a deck, the digital signal processor outputs a focus control signal to control a focus of an optical recording medium, measures a tilt with respect to the optical recording medium, and outputs a tilt adjustment signal and a switch control signal so as to adjust the tilt. The first drive integrated circuit either synthesizes the tilt adjustment signal and the focus control signal or receives only the focus control signal according to the switch control signal and then outputs the synthesized signal or the focus control signal to the optical pickup. The tilt adjuster synthesizes the tilt adjustment signal output from the first drive integrated circuit and the focus control signal and then outputs the synthesized signal to the optical pickup.
